Commercial f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and restore properties affected by fire damage. These services typically include removing soot, smoke, and debris, cleaning and deodorizing affected areas, and repairing structural damage caused by the fire or firefighting efforts. The goal is to return the property to a safe, functional condition while minimizing downtime for businesses and property owners. Experienced service providers utilize specialized equipment and techniques to ensure thorough cleaning and restoration, helping properties recover from the devastating impact of fire incidents.
This type of restoration work addresses a range of problems that can occur after a fire. Smoke and soot can penetrate walls, ceilings, and HVAC systems, leading to persistent odors and potential health hazards. Structural damage may weaken the integrity of the building, requiring repairs to walls, flooring, or roofing. Additionally, water used to extinguish the fire can cause water damage, leading to mold growth if not properly handled. Commercial fire restoration services help solve these issues by providing targeted cleaning, repairs, and mitigation strategies to prevent further deterioration and restore the property's safety and appearance.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Fire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aurora,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fire damage restoration in commercial properties range from $250 to $600. Many routine cleanup and repair jobs fall within this range, especially for small areas or surface damage.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range.
Moderate Restoration - Medium-sized fire restoration projects often c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ects usually involve significant cleaning, minor repairs, and smoke odor removal, which are common for many commercial sites. Some larger jobs can reach $5,000 or more depending on scope.
Extensive Damage Repair - Larger, more complex fire restoration efforts can range from $5,000 to $15,000. These projects typically involve extensive structural repairs, full cleaning, and rebuilding, which are less frequent but necessary for severe damage cases.
Full Replacement - Complete restoration or rebuilding after severe fire damage can cost $20,000 or more. Such projects are less common and depend heavily on the size and complexity of the affected area, often requiring comprehensive reconstruction services from local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
